OpenAI's AI model solves 80-year-old maths problem. This marks a major AI breakthrough.
OpenAI's AI model has made a groundbreaking achievement by autonomously solving a famous 80-year-old maths problem, marking a significant milestone for artificial intelligence. This breakthrough demonstrates the potential of advanced AI systems to contribute original work in technical fields, such as mathematics and scientific research.
